A WILDLIFE ranger yesterday informed the court that he could not present a live chameleon allegedly linked to an attempted witchcraft plot against President Hakainde Hichilema, stating that the reptile had been taken to Munda Wanga Rehabilitation Centre.
This case involves a Mozambican Jasten Mabulesse Candude and a Zambian Lenard Phiri, who are accused of attempting to harm the President through alleged acts of witchcraft.
